What they do

A Transportation Supervisor managers internal distribution for a company, or transportation for a company that ships packages to customers. Assigns and directs drivers, coordinates transportation schedules, and monitors trucks or delivery vehicles. May supervise transportation services for a school district, higher education institution, or a recreational or corporate campus. Coordinates routes, assigns drivers, and monitors vehicle operations.

Job Description

Waste Connections has an immediate opening for an Operations Supervisor to join our team in Clarksville, TN . Our Operations Supervisor will work directly with the Operations Manager to formulate both short-term and long-term goals and action plans for the hauling company. We seek individuals with a leadership mentality and desire to grow with promotional opportunities in this role.
Waste Connections offers:
Competitive Compensation. Benefits Plans - Flexible Spending Accounts and Health Savings Account options. Generous matching 401(K) and Paid Time Off.
Schedule:
~4:30am start time averaging approximately 10-11 hours/day. Monday-Friday with occasional Saturdays.
Benefits:
We offer excellent benefits including: medical, dental, vision, flexible spending account, long term & short term disability, life insurance, 401(K).
Duties and Responsibilities:
Assign and supervise work crews operating solid waste collection equipment. Monitor progress of daily operations, reassign employees, and make staffing changes as necessary. Helps develop, track, and execute safety goals. Conducts field inspections and audits of all site personnel to ensure proper work procedures. Receives and reviews customer complaints regarding collection programs. Oversees a variety of complex compliance programs including environmental, OSHA, and local permitting.
Requirements:
Willing and able to obtain Class A or B CDL. Must be able to relocate for promotional opportunities based on performance. Ability to work in all weather conditions.
